Mumbai to get India's first geriatrics hospital at Mazgaon
India, Sept. 17 -- Mumbai is set to get the country's first geriatric care hospital, a facility to be developed by Aga Khan Health Services India at Mazgaon. Prince Aga Khan V, who has bought a one-acre plot to house the facility, discussed the plan with the chief minister on Monday but the formalities are yet to be finalised.
"Our community has purchased a plot at Mazgaon. It currently has Phillips quarters, which will be demolished to construct a geriatrics hospital," said Amin Manekia, chairperson of Aga Khan Health Services.
